Djibouti , officially the Republic of Djibouti, is a country in the Horn of Africa, bordered by Somalia to the south, Ethiopia to the southwest, Eritrea in the north, and the Red Sea and the Gulf of Aden to the east. The country has an area of 23,200 km (8,958 sq mi). WebDjibouti, Arabic Jībūtī, port city and capital of the Republic of Djibouti. It lies on the southern shore of the Gulf of Tadjoura, which is an inlet of the Gulf of Aden. Built on three level areas (Djibouti, Serpent, Marabout) linked by jetties, the city has a mixture of old and modern architecture. Menilek Square contains the government palace. WebApr 13, 2024 · The Day Forest National Park is situated to the west of Tadjoura, coming under the Tadjoura region. Founded in 1939, the park is in the Goda Mountains region, considered as the largest forest in Djibouti with an area of 13,900 hectors. The highlights of the park are the junipers Juniperus procera trees growing up to height of 20 meters.
WebMay 18, 2024 · Meta's 2Africa subsea cable has landed in Djibouti City, Djibouti. Djibouti Telecom announced on 13 May that the country’s 9th subsea cable, which is 45,000 km long, had landed in the capital. At 45,000 km and circling the African continent, the subsea cable is the longest fiber optic cable in the world and will connect three continents ... WebDjibouti is home to military bases that France and the US use for their anti-terrorism missions. European navies use the Djibouti port for their Somali anti-piracy program. By 2015 the government was said to be conducting negotiations with China, its main economic partner, and Russia to allow them to maintain a military presence in the country.
